Software Systems Architect
Ville : Ottawa, Ontario, Canada
Catégorie : Engineering
Industrie : Telecommunications
Employeur : Ciena
Ciena is committed to our people-first philosophy. Our teams enjoy a culture focused on prioritizing a personalized and flexible work environment that empowers an individual’s passions, growth, wellbeing and belonging. We’re a technology company that leads with our humanity—driving our business priorities alongside meaningful social, community, and societal impact.
Not ready to apply? Join our Talent Community to get relevant job alerts straight to your inbox.
As a System Architect with the Ciena Optical Networks System Design Architecture team you will play a crucial role designing complex networking solutions that meets the current and future needs of our customers. In this role you will work closely with a cross-functional team to support the evolution of our existing product portfolio and the development of new, next generation products.
Responsibilities
Product Design
- Work with Product Line Management (PLM) to define the initial set of requirements for a specific customer request or new general market need
- Work with the various design teams while iterating through the possible software options to address the requirements and present the design tradeoffs of the various options
- Define the solution requirements in sufficient detail for design teams to implement the design; outputs include both high level specifications as well as detailed requirements
- Provide support to design teams during the design phase
Product Integration
- Provide input into software characterization, integration, system test and product verification test plans as required
- Provide support to design teams to resolve issues that arise during testing
- Execute or guide the execution of the system level test plan
Customer Interaction
- Create product supporting documentation for PLM to describe new technologies, solutions, and product designs to customers
- Present to customer account teams and customers are required
- Provide support when field issues are escalated to the design teams
Cross-functional Support and Alignment
- Ensure the design teams are aligned with the proposed solution and understand the requirements to implement the design
- Ensure the management team is informed about any issues that arise during product design and integration that require escalation
- Ensure PLM are informed about any roadblocks that arise during product design and integration that may require changes to the product definition
Qualifications
- Bachelor’s degree in Computer Engineering, Electrical Engineering, Computer Science, or a related field.
- Experience or interest in system design, preferably in the telecommunications industry
- Knowledge of networking protocols, software technologies, and architectures
- Experience with embedded and application software development, testing and validation as well as hardware and software integration
- Excellent problem-solving and analytical skills, with the ability to think critically and propose innovative solutions.
- Strong communication and collaboration skills, with the ability to work effectively in cross-functional teams.
- Self-motivated and able to work independently
- Ability to multitask and prioritize tasks in a fast-paced, deadline-driven environment.
#LI-JD
At Ciena, we are committed to building and fostering an environment in which our employees feel respected, valued, and heard. Ciena values the diversity of its workforce and respects its employees as individuals. We do not tolerate any form of discrimination.